The Block Party is the second book in the Holiday series from Nicole Pyland – a series that I LOVED the first book, The Writing on the Wall, and I wanted to know what would happen to some of the characters that were introduced.

I thought that just with the first one, Pyland nails it. She’s able to write these complicated and unique characters in a way that makes me fall in love with them separately AND together. Sometimes the one character is the clear winner, but in Pyland’s books (The Block Party included), each character has their own quirks and things that make them unique. But they are so cute alone and even cuter together.

I was further into this book than I expected before I realized why it was called The Block Party, but once I realized it, it was a sheer sprint to the finish to see how it would end up. I knew from Pyland’s other books that this was going to weave in and out of the main story and it had moments where they talked about where they saw each other/how they “met” before they met. And it all revolves around the same group of friends, extending out to the friends of those friends. Weaving together a tapestry of great stories that all work together and on their own (like Pyland’s characters)… wait a minute, I’m seeing a trend here!

Overall, The Block Party was excellent. I had tears in my eyes numerous times, and I enjoyed the growth/growing aspects of this one. I know that every human has moments where they need to figure out the next step(s), but I always find that in stories like The Block Party, I enjoy the struggles before knowing the solution, or at least the next step is right around the corner. Each of Pyland’s characters feels very real and exhibits characteristics of friends of mine who have gone through similar struggles, making her books that much better.

Add in the excellent narration by Carolyn Eve, and this was one that I devoured and one where I cannot wait to read other stories in the same universe/timeline.

Book Description:

The Block Party Audiobook Cover

This is book two in the Holiday Series.

Talon Mitchell had gotten a job right out of college, had her own coffee mug at the office that no one else could use, and planned to keep her job as sales manager for a long time, because she had practically grown up working for this company. She was content and not looking for anything, when a new sales director showed up and changed everything.

Emerson Bagley just got a new job, and while she felt ready for the next step, when she sees someone she recognizes from a holiday party working on the same team, she can’t believe her luck – both good and bad. Good, because Talon Mitchell was very attractive, very smart, and seemingly, very interested in Emerson, too. Bad, because she couldn’t date someone who worked for her, especially in her brand-new job.

Feeling the simmering heat begin to boil over, the two women decide to at least take one step, and deal with the rest later. When neither of them had been prepared to seek out love, they managed to find it where they least expected it.
